How to fix ice maker on Sub-Zero?
Fixing a Sub-Zero ice maker requires a structured approach. Start by checking the water filter, as a clogged one can prevent ice production. Replace it if necessary. Next, inspect the water inlet valve and water line for any obstructions or kinks. If ice cubes are small or misshapen, ensure there's adequate water pressure. By addressing these common issues, you can often restore functionality. How much does it cost to replace a Sub-Zero ice maker?
The cost of replacing a Sub-Zero ice maker can range from $200 to $600, depending on the model and the complexity of the installation. This includes the price of the new ice maker unit and professional service fees. How long do Sub-Zero ice makers last?
Sub-Zero ice makers are designed for durability, typically lasting 10 to 15 years with proper maintenance. Regular cleaning, timely filter replacements, and prompt attention to any issues can further extend their lifespan. Can hard water affect my Sub-Zero ice maker?
Yes, hard water can indeed impact your ice maker. It can lead to mineral buildup in the water line and other components, reducing water flow and affecting ice quality.
